Social Responsibility

Together with the Corporación Valora Foundation, Emergia operates its Corporate Social Responsibility Plan, titled “emHelp”, in two ways. First, it donates a percentage of its income to the foundation, and second, Emergia’s employees act as Valora Volunteers, taking part in some of the projects carried out by the foundation.

A Selection of Corporación Valora’s Foundation Projects:

  • Since 2005. Sponsorship of 20 children in the San Marcos department, 250 km away from Guatemala City, in the San Pablo village, Guatemala. WORLD VISION.
  • 2006. Conferral of 200 micro credits (180 credits for women and 20 for men) for community banks to be runed in Santa Cruz City, Bolivia. WORLD VISION.
  • 2007. Construction of a school in Kadadarabenchi, India. VICENTE FERRER FOUNDATION.
  • 2007. Concession of 25 scholarships to form in sciences and technologies students belonging to a low caste in India. VICENTE FERRER FOUNDATION.
  • 2007. “Mother's Project” to help single mothers who have no resources in Baix Llobregat, Barcelona, Spain. CARITAS.
  • 2007. Support of the “Mankind & Development” program to help victims of domestic violence in Morocco. INTERMÓN OXFAM.
  • 2007. Food safety poroject for families through the management of laying hens corrals and beehives in Guatemala. WORLD VISION.
  • 2008. "Alexandra Project” to support victims of domestic violence in Spain. This is one of FUNDACIÓN CORPORACIÓN VALORA's own projects.
  • 2008. Construction of a well that provides with water more than 2,500 families from the same region in South Africa. GLOBAL WATER FOUNDATION.
  • 2009. Construction of emergency houses for families that live in an extreme poverty situation in Manizales, Colombia. UN TECHO PARA MI PAÍS.
  • 2010. Collaboration with the house - home that offers support to cancer ill children and their families to carry out the treatment and to coexist with this disease, Bogota, Colombia. FUNSTALL FOUNDATION.
  • 2011. New edition of the iniciative - born within Emergia in 2009 - to collect money and support for a Christmas celebration with institutions, neighbourhoods, homes or comunities with lack of resources. CHRISTMAS WITH SENSE.

         

     

 

Adhesion to the United Nations Global Compact

By virtue of the adhesion of EMERGIA to the world-wide Pact of the United Nations (Global Compact), Emergia is voluntarily committed to fulfill the 10 Principles of Social Responsibility of the world-wide Pact of the United Nations.

That is support and respect the protection of the human rights; make sure that their companies do not harm them; uphold the freedom of association and the right to collective bargaining. Also, support the elimination of force and compulsory labour, eradicate child labour and pursuit the abolition of discrimination within employment and occupation. Protect the environment, promote environmental responsibility and develop and spread enviromental friendly technologies. And finally, work against the corruption in all its forms, including extortion and bribery.
